WELCOME PAUL PISCAPO, FITNESS EDGE PERSONAL TRAINERS AND FITNESS EDGE CLIENTS!  On 1/1/09, the highly respected Fitness Edge business merged all operations into Foreside Fitness & Tennis, LLC.  Honestly, we’d (FIT) been working on this for over a year.  We share common health pursuits and goals that are certain to strengthen and benefit all.   We are thrilled that you’re all with us!

WE HIT A BIG BUSINESS MILESTONE ON THE FITNESS SIDE!  Our overhead requires a minimum of 450 (annualized monthly average) fitness members to succeed given our current level of services.  We’re very pleased to report, on January 17th, we hit (and passed) the 450 target!  We cannot stress enough how appreciative we are of everyone’s support.  Especially in these difficult economic times.  Thank you so very much.

For well over a year, we have worked hard to develop and bring to you, Foreside Fitness & Tennis, LLC.  We created an initial plan, developed budgets, researched numbers, located equipment and systems, capitalized and put our plan into action, rennovated our building, installed our new overhead…and the results are what you see.  And it appears you do like what you see!

Opening business, by all accounts, has been very brisk.  Costs are high too, but we are exceeding our goals on the Tennis side.  And we’ll continue to work to (better) develop leagues, lessons and new programs.  On the Fitness side, we’ve quickly established a steady pattern of growth.  Aerobics classes attendance is strong.  And we just passed the 250 paid-clients mark.  Stay tuned.
